Contract Opportunity: Principal Engineer - Product Safety (Safety & Environmental) Location: Barrow-in-Furness - Hybrid (2 days onsite per month) Duration: 6 monthsRate: £74.68/hr Umbrella or £55.31/hr PAYE (inside IR35) Clearance: SC required to start (Sole UK Nationals only) The Role: Join BAE Systems' Submarines division as a Principal Product Safety Engineer, working as part of a high-performing Integrated Development Team (IDT). You'll play a key role in delivering submarine systems and capabilities across the full engineering lifecycle, focusing on ensuring product safety is embedded and maintained across multiple complex systems. This is a fantastic opportunity to gain in-depth exposure to submarine capability and system-of-systems integration within a safety-critical defence environment. Key Responsibilities: Deliver Product Safety tasking and activities aligned to engineering lifecycle milestones Support Hazard Identification and Analysis studies Produce and assist in the generation of safety documentation and reports Ensure compliance with the Safety Management System across the project Liaise with IDTs and Whole Boat Safety Teams Promote a strong SHE (Safety, Health & Environment) culture across the programmeYour Skills & Experience: Essential: Strong understanding of Safety & Systems Engineering Experience delivering safety-related engineering tasks, both independently and as part of a team Excellent verbal and written communication skills Self-motivated and adaptable to changing customer requirements Degree-qualified (2:2 or above) in an Engineering disciplineDesirable: Maritime/Defence sector experience as a Product Safety Engineer Familiarity with relevant standards such as ISO 26262, IEC 61508, and IEC 15288 Experience applying ALARP principles, managing safety data, and contributing to safety cases Ready to make an impact on national defence and safety?
